    Go Wild! conJane Goodall

    THE PROGRAM

    Go Wild! with Jane Goodall is an Earth Train and Jane GoodallsRoots & Shoots program, designed to educate children and youthabout Panamanian wild animal conservation and welfare issuesthrough project-based learning; to offer children and youth a tasteof real world wild animal conservation and welfare work (e.g. pro-

    posal writing, educational project development); and to empowerfuture leaders in these elds.

    The program launched with a 3-phase contest that ran betweenJuly and October 2013, with over 200 participants from 9 differentschools. We are now proud to announce the winners of the rst GoWild! with Jane Goodall contest, and invite you to a private eventin the company of Dr. Jane Goodall.

    Dr. Jane Goodall

    familiar-seeming lives. The public was fascinated and remains so to this day.

    In April 2002, Secretary-General Ko Annan named Dr. Goodall, a UN Messenger of Peace. He

    cited her for her dedication to what is best in mankind and presented her with a lapel pin in the

    image of a dove. Secretary-General Ban Ki-moon renewed Dr. Goodalls appointment as a UN

    Messenger of Peace when he took ofce in 2007.

    Today, Janes work revolves around inspiring action on behalf of endangered species, particularly

    chimpanzees, and encouraging people to do their part to make the world a better place for people,

    animals, and the environment we all share.

    Dr. Goodall carries her message of peace with the natural world through her worldwide outreach

    efforts, the mission and work of the Jane Goodall Institute, and especially through the Institutes

    global environmental and humanitarian youth program, Jane Goodalls Roots &

    Shoots. With members in more than 120 countries, Jane Goodalls Roots & Shoots

    provides young people with the knowledge, tools and hopeful inspiration to better

    their environment and improve the quality of life of people and animals.

    The Jane Goodall Institue

    of young people who have learned to care deeply for their human community, for all animals, and

    for the environment; and who will take responsible action to care for them, improve global un-

    derstanding, and contribute to their preservation by combining conservation with education and

    promotion of sustainable livelihoods in local communities.

    The Jane Goodall Institute protects chimpanzees; works with people and communities to restore

    and protect critical habitats; helps improve livelihoods in communities where it works; andeducates the public and policymakers about the important connections between their own lives and

    policies and the well-being of species, habitats and humans in critical conservation areas around

    the world. These are done through direct work by JGI staff; community-based

    conservation programs, a variety of partnerships and collaborations; and through

    Jane Goodalls Roots & Shoots program, a global environmental and humanitarian

    network of youth leaders, active in more than 100 countries.

    Earth Train Foundation

    learning and coaching opportunities for youth-led organizations and emerging leaders in elds

    related to ecological restoration, nature-based education, nature appreciation, wildlife

    conservation, and sustainable design for community development. Our emphasis on experiential

    learning, systems thinking, a coaching relationship between experienced and emerging leaders,

    peer-to-peer teaching and mentoring, effectively stimulates a multiplier effect as youth helps youth

    realize their leadership potential.Earth Train is the founder and manager of the Mamon Valley reserve, a 4,000-hectare ecological

    protection and restoration reserve located in the province of Panama, around the

    upper Ro Mamon. The reserve, in addition to serving as a buffer zone

    protecting 18 kilometers of the southern border of Guna Yala and the eastern edge

    of the Chagres National Park, is Earth Trains rural campus serving indigenous

    community leaders, educators, children, college students, lm-makers, artists, re-

    searchers, and nature guides-in training.
